The Brain on Screens: EEG Markers of Brain Homeostasis versus Deregulation and how excessive Screen use can interfere with successful outcomes in Neuro and Biofeedback interventions.

With countries and states banning cell phones in schools, social media for under 18, and legalizing boundaries of work/home device use, society is catching up with the science that certain types of use / excess are not good for our brains and biology.  But are bans necessary? Are there better solutions? And how can you tell if excess screen interactive screen use is interfering with brain health?

This presentation will explore explicit EEG markers associated with excess (interactive technology interference on the EEG) versus typical modern use (healthy integration).  Dr. Mari Swingle will demonstrate the connection with excess and the development or ‘manufacturing’ of ADHD, anxiety and depression as well as the broader effects on the socio-emotional and cognitive development of children. She will also look at the matured brain and EEG patterns seen rather universally across the life span.
